As Ford loses billions on EVs, the corporate embraces hybrids

Heads up, hybrid fans: Ford Motor is working on a entire bunch of unusual hybrid fashions.

“It’s likely you’ll be going to search worthy extra hybrid programs from us,” CEO Jim Farley mentioned Thursday after the corporate reported 2nd-quarter earnings that published widening losses on its electrical vehicles unit.

The feedback chase rather counter to recent messaging from the Detroit automakers, which have touted the performance and recognition of all-electrical favorites because the industry strikes to meet EV targets. The hybrid hype, alternatively, falls extra closely in line with worldwide hybrid chief Toyota, which has faced criticism for what some saw as resistance to the EV transition.

To be sure, Ford is never in actuality turning a ways from its worthy-touted EV push, though it mentioned Thursday that its EV ramp-up would possibly clutch longer than it had beforehand anticipated.

Nonetheless even because it spends billions to ramp up EV manufacturing, it be planning to bring extra hybrid ideas to market, pushed by the success of its recent fuel-electrical ideas.

“Now we were shocked, frankly, at the recognition of hybrid programs for F-150,” Farley mentioned for the duration of Ford’s 2nd-quarter earnings call. Extra than 10% of F-150 pickup customers are choosing the hybrid model, Farley mentioned, and that share has been rising.

Ford also supplies a hybrid version of its little Maverick pickup. That has been to take into accounta good higher success, Farley mentioned, with extra than half of Maverick buyers — 56% — selecting the $1,500 non-compulsory hybrid powertrain over the regular four-cylinder engine.

Nonetheless why double down on hybrids factual because the industry is making a stout push in direction of pure EVs?

“What the buyer in actuality likes is when we clutch a hybrid plan that is extra efficient for obvious accountability cycles after which we add recent capabilities thanks to the batteries,” Farley mentioned.

Amongst these recent capabilities: Ford’s “Expert Energy Onboard” plan, which supplies customers the flexibility to faucet the truck’s electricity by process of outlets in the pickup mattress to vitality tools at a job attach of dwelling — or a refrigerator at a tailgate bag together — taking away the favor to elevate a separate generator.

“We’re seeing heaps of buyers fancy that mixture of the utilize of the batteries for something previous factual transferring the automotive,” Farley mentioned. “And so we’re factual taking sign of the market.”

Ford has closely promoted the capabilities of its battery-electrical F-150 Lightning pickup, which supplies the flexibility to vitality a entire condominium for numerous days.

It will likely be that in hearing from customers, Ford has particular the recognition of that capacity is outrunning the willingness to chase all electrical. As executives well-known Thursday, EV adoption is transferring extra slowly than anticipated.

So, in the meantime, Ford can offer vitality-hungry but EV-wary drivers an in-between option, with hybrid ideas all the contrivance in which via its internal-combustion lineup.

“Nonetheless assemble no longer agree with them in the earlier sense of an Rupture out hybrid or a [Toyota] Prius,” Farley mentioned. “They’re doubtlessly going to come to light in any other case than most folk think.”

“And customers fancy that.”
